Application

The TQ100 Air Permeability Tester adopts high technology to measure the air permeability of various materials. It supports the Schopper method, Bentsen method, and Gurley method.

Standards

ISO 5636-2, ISO 5636-3, ISO 5636-5, ISO 2965

Working Principle

By maintaining a constant pressure difference between the two sides of the sample, the air permeability is obtained by measuring the amount of air passing through a specific area within a specific time.
